The shared history of the Nordic countries goes back more than a thousand years. There have been periods of both friendship and conflict, but what colonial legacy and responsibility do we Scandinavians carry with us?
THE COLONISTS is an interactive dance performance that takes a critical look at our shared heritage—one that many prefer to forget—and at the colonial structures that still exist today. Embedded in a satirical atmosphere, the audience observes and participates in an exploration of power and abuse of power. THE COLONISTS is a cascade of choreography, voice, and musical interplay in an interactive context, where five dancers occupy and conquer the stage.
Choreographers: Michael Tang and Lava Markusson
Dancers: Alexander Montgomery Andersen, Sarah Aviaja, Moa Autio, Yorgos Pelagias, and Michael Tang
Composer: Hans-Ole Amossen
Set Designer: Sámal Blak
Lighting Designer: Tanya Theo Johansson
Bobbi Lo Production is a dance company focused on creating inclusive performing arts for all ages. Their artistic work is in direct dialogue with contemporary society, characterized by openness and a willingness to take risks. They take human behavior as their starting point and explore how performing arts for young audiences can raise questions and foster dialogue around these themes.
